The scope of legal protection for listed buildings

This List entry helps identify the building designated at this address for its special architectural or historic interest.

Unless the List entry states otherwise, it includes both the structure itself and any object or structure fixed to it (whether inside or outside) as well as any object or structure within the curtilage of the building.

For these purposes, to be included within the curtilage of the building, the object or structure must have formed part of the land since before 1st July 1948.

Details

BRIDESTOWE
SK 58 NW

12/48 Cranford Cottage
-

- II

Cottage. Circa early C19. Colourwashed rubble walls. Gable ended asbestos slate
roof. Rendered stack at right gable end.
2-room plan with direct entry into larger heated right-hand room which was
kitchen/living room. To the left-hand side is the staircase at the front with a
small dairy at the rear. In the C20 a bathroom was added at the rear of the house
in a single storey extension.
2 storeys. Asymmetrical 2 window front of 2-light C19 small-paned casements. Early
C20 plank door to left of centre. There is no ground floor window to its left where
the stairs are situated. At the rear to the right is the dairy window. C20 lean-to
to its left.
Interior is very unaltered. The principal room has an open fireplace which formerly
contained a range.
This is a little altered example of a modest form of building which is now fast
disappearing.
